Output 675878133cba81d7e64d1ef7ebdadae5541281a29ca9a0ee86e30601d1b2911a:0

value
15900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bce93dd7d5302b729ad5b38e6f828ac772dc6b9 OP_EQUAL
address
3A4StGEdaaB2MPkJMeqyMpCWrPimZj7L6D
transaction
675878133cba81d7e64d1ef7ebdadae5541281a29ca9a0ee86e30601d1b2911a
spent
true